In article <3j4rbeFo6g2nU2nospamvidual.net>, DaveHinznospamcop.net says... > > > I would think that the impact very probably took a few years off the > > control arm bushings and engine mounts and may have well have knocked the > > alignment out a bit. But given competent repair work, it is very easily > > repairable as described. > > Yes, that's where my concerns would be also. Anything that took a load > in a direction it normally wouldn't, so suspension & mounts, also > steering maybe, depending on a few things. Worth having a 4-wheel > alignment check done, but not a reason not to buy it. > > The only downer I can see here (as long as he has the relevant VIC certificate) is that I have to notify the my insurance that it is a crashed repaired former total loss vehicle that I am insuring. They will reduce the value, and increase the premium for that reason. -- Carl Robson Car PC Build starts again. http://smallr.com/rz Homepage: http://www.bouncing-czechs.com
